Golf is simple – until you take into account all the Newtonian physics that can affect the flight of the golf ball. And you have to add in the physical abilities and psychological quirks of the golfer that further complicate the game of golf. Good governance should also be simple. But governance is not based on physics but on psychology. And while the golfer must contend with the physical challenges on the golf course and the weather, government must contend with the psychological interaction of millions of citizens. In this episode, the Edifice of Trust host, Victor Bolles, looks at ways to cope with these challenges.
